處理規則使用案例
您可在組織內使用處理規則的應用程式非常廣泛。 以下幾節將詳細說明您可能會使用它們的一些常見方式。
處理規則用於將值從內容資料變數移至Props和eVars。 若沒有處理規則,內容資料變數就毫無意義,且不會填入 Analytics 的任何報告。
內容變數清單包含過去30天內傳送至報表套裝的所有變數。 如果您知道上下文資料變數的名稱但尚未將它傳送至目前的報表套裝,您可以手動新增:
下列範例接受search_term
內容資料變數並將其值放入eVar3:
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| search_term (內容資料)已設定 |
動作 | 以覆寫search_term eVar3的值(內容資料) |
如果只有少數幾個 eVar 可填入,上述範例非常實用。如果您的組織有數百個上下文資料變數,每個變數都需要專屬 eVar,建議使用條件陳述式。符合單一處理規則的條件陳述式有數十個,方便您的組織填入報表套裝中的所有 eVar,不需受限於 150 個處理規則的上限。
下列範例會將各種上下文資料變數填入多個變數中。 一個動作也包含條件陳述式:
table 0-row-2 1-row-2 2-row-2 3-row-2 | |
---|---|
規則集 | 值 |
動作 | 以覆寫spa.billing_customer_name eVar55的值(內容資料) |
動作 | 如果已設定 (內容資料),請使用 (內容資料)覆寫testhierarchy Prop7的值testhierarchy |
動作 | 以覆寫spa.ims_org eVar8的值(內容資料) |
處理規則可根據內容資料變數觸發事件。
內容變數清單包含過去30天內傳送至報表套裝的所有變數。 如果您知道上下文資料變數的名稱但尚未將它傳送至目前的報表套裝,您可以手動新增:
下列規則定義會在每個包含特定內容資料變數的點選上設定事件:
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| search_term (內容資料)已設定 |
動作 | 將Event Event1設為自訂值 1 |
您可以使用查詢字串引數填入變數。 在大多數情況下,您通常會調整實施以取得所需的查詢字串值。 不過,如果您無法輕鬆調整實作以收集此資料,處理規則是個適當的替代方案。 如果發生打字錯誤或類似問題因而無法填入值,您可使用處理規則來填入值。
覆寫值之前,請務必先檢查值是否空白或包含預期值。
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| 行銷活動未設定 |
動作 | 以查詢字串引數覆寫促銷活動的值cpid |
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| 查詢字串引數 q 已設定 |
動作 | 以查詢字串引數覆寫個內部搜尋詞的值q |
可以根據處理規則中可用的任何條件來設定事件。 例如,您可以在頁面名稱等於「產品概述」時觸發事件。
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| 如果Page Name等於「產品概述」 |
動作 | 設定事件 產品檢視為自訂值 1 |
您可使用串連選項結合其他值,用來填入值。
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| 無(一律執行) |
動作 | 以串連值類別+頁面名稱覆寫 eVar1的值 |
您可以比對值是否有拼字錯誤,並加以更新以在報表中正確顯示。
Adobe建議您儘可能使用最嚴格的比對選項,以避免不想要的覆寫。 您可以對變數執行報告,並搜尋您要使用的潛在規則條件。 字串比較不區分大小寫。
table 0-row-2 1-row-2 2-row-2 | |
---|---|
規則集 | 值 |
條件 | 如果prop1 開頭為 "Shoping" |
動作 | 以自訂值覆寫 Prop1的值Shopping |
您可以使用處理規則從點選中移除或捨棄特定事件,而不變更您的實作。 如果您將事件設為自訂值0
,則事件不會計入。
| 規則集 | 值 |
| 條件 | 無(一律執行) |
| 動作 | 將event Event1設為自訂值 0
|